Fertilizing is fundamental to supporting plant health and accomplishing lush, vibrant landscapes. Plants require a balanced supply of nutrients-- mainly n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ce plentiful blooms, and preserve dynamic foliage. A soil test is the initial step in identifying what nutrients are lacking, ensuring that the selected fertilizer meets the particular needs of the site. Fertilizers come in numerous forms, consisting of granular, liquid, natural, and artificial, each offering different release rates and advantages. Using the ideal type at the correct time is essential to prevent nutrient overflow, root burn, or uneven development. Seasonal timing, such as using greater n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, helps plants prepare for growth spurts or withstand winter tension. Consistent fertilization not just improves plant look but likewise strengthens strength against bugs, diseases, and ecological stress factors. A well-fed landscape is more likely to flourish every year, supplying both beauty and environmental worth
